a tubing DIY kit would be approximately 200-300 range for aluminized steel, $75 more for 409ss.

I would sell it with hangers, but they would need to be bent and trimmed to fit. This allows for maximum flexability for the install. Ideally cut off your stock flange & reuse it. Unless i stumble upon a sutible solution for that.

Im doubtful demand would be enough to justify a full, bolt on kit that requires no work. I'll have to be moving a few kits a week to justify making the jigs for that.

mostly...i use a slip connection where the flanged connection would be. Any axle-back can be quickly adapted to my exhaust by cutting the flange off & making a slip fit adapter
